A Meditation Journal

Today, pick your favourite meditation from the 10 we have posted on here.  Sometimes it nice to revisit the past journeys and take them again.  Things change, the healing that took place on our previous meditations has changed your energies. 

By revisiting a meditation, you can allow your subconscious or your higher self to take this healing further.  You can see the next stages of your journey, you can heal at a deeper level!

Keeping a journal of your meditations, your thoughts, feelings, emotions that have come to the surface is a great way chart your healing journey.  At the end of every meditation, make a short note.  Be honest with your writing, take note of exactly how you are feeling.

Then, every few weeks or months, look back, read through your journal, identify the most powerful meditations for you, give yourself permission for healing to take place.

Entering Into Silence

Today we are going for a slightly harder meditation, its not guided, there are no words or real instructions to follow.  Don't worry if you are new to meditation and find you can't keep in meditation for a long time, for just a few moments of this powerful meditation can produce wonderful healing.

We are going to be entering into silence.  Before we do this, have a think about what noises you can hear right now.  Is the TV on in the background?  Are you listening to music?  Can you hear noises outside in the street?

Our lives are now filled with a constant noise.  Music playing in shops, traffic, people, everywhere we go there is almost a constant backing track!  Today, even if just for a few moments we are going to try and enter into our own personal silence.  By doing this we will be getting in touch with our inner being, listening not to outside noise, but to our bodies, energy system and possibly our higher self.

To do this meditation:

Take yourself into your meditation space
light a candle, but do not play your usual relaxing music
make yourself comfortable
breathe

Take 5 long deep breaths
now breathe normally
at first you will notice every single noise
your mind will whirl, random thoughts will appear

Take 5 further long deep breaths
every time you notice a noise
imagine you are turning down the volume
see yourself turning down the volume

Do this for all thoughts, for all noises

Enter into the silence

Try and keep in your own personal silence for as long as you can.  If you only manage 1 minute, accept that this is how long you needed.  You can always try again tomorrow.  Do not judge how long you were in the silence for, just accept.

Taking time for YOU!

Often, when looking after others, we forget to look after the most important person.  YOU!  Taking time for yourself is not selfish or self indulgent, after all if you do not invest in some self care, you will be in no fit state to look after others. 

You really can only give to others what you have learnt to receive yourself.  Self care is not a waste of time or money and is certainly something that you should never feel guilty about.  Think about Your time as an investment you are making on behalf of your friends and family.  When you are relaxed and happy, they can be relaxed and happy in your presence.

Self care has many aspects.  You can invest in a Massage or Reiki treatment, take time out for some Meditation (hopefully if you are a regular reader of this blog you will be spending at least 10 minutes each day, reading the meditations and using them for you!) take a long walk in nature, taking a long hot bath with bubbles and candles, or even just as simple as switching off your PC, taking the phone off the hook and enjoying a nice cup if tea.

If we do not look after ourselves we will find we start running low on energy, eventually we will need to stop, as there will be no more energy!  Fill your cup first, make yourself strong, for that WILL allow you to be strong for others!

The 10 Minute Meditator

You may have found this blog totally by accident, but really, is there such thing as accident?  Maybe your subconscious has led you here today to help you start connecting with your body, start focusing your mind and to help you manifest the life you long.

Today is just a quick 10 minute meditation for you.  It is here to help you unlock the myths surrounding meditation and to show you exactly what meditation is.

First, find a comfortable place to sit, be sure that you wont be interrupted for at least 10 minutes.  It might be a good idea to turn off your mobile phone, turn on some relaxing music and perhaps light a candle.  Come on, lets really get in the mode for meditation!

Consciously relax your body.  For now, to do this, just make sure you are comfortable.  Let your mind lead you to where there is discomfort in the body and when you realise where this is, shift a little, become comfortable again, and repeat this process until you are settled.

When you are ready, close your eyes and breathe.  Take long slow breaths, really feel the air flowing in and out of your lungs.

Now is not the time to try and get a totally clear mind, it is virtually impossible unless you have studied meditation for years to empty your mind of all thought.  Just allow the thoughts to come and then to pass.  Don't judge what you are thinking, just be at peace in the knowledge that the thoughts are there. 

When you are ready, it will be time to bring yourself back to the present.  Take your time, open your eyes, take a sip of water, stand, shake out your arms and maybe do some neck rolls. 

Try and do this light and simple meditation at the beginning of the day to help focus the mind and become prepared for the challenges that the day may bring you!
